Do I need a police clearance letter?

The criminal background check letter is generally not mandatory for the H-2A visa, but consulting official sources is essential to confirm the required documents.

The H-2A visa is intended for temporary agricultural workers, and the process usually requires various documents to prove eligibility and security. Many doubts arise regarding the need to present a police clearance letter, and this matter can vary depending on the applicant”s specific case.

Generally, for the H-2A visa, it is not common for a criminal background check letter to be requested as a mandatory part of the process. However, depending on the personal history or specific requirements identified during the consular review, there may be a need to present additional documents clarifying the candidate”s situation with local authorities.

Thus, if you already have this document, having it on hand can help expedite the process if it is required. It is essential to follow the guidance of American authorities and comply with United States immigration laws. For this reason, it is recommended to consult official sources, such as the U.S. Department of State website or the American Embassy/Consulate, to confirm the documents required in your particular situation.

Additionally, seeking assistance from professionals or companies specialized in immigration can clarify doubts and guide on how to avoid scams and marketing campaigns that promise miraculous results. Staying well informed and following official guidelines is crucial to ensure your visa process follows the proper procedures and avoids future complications.

If there is any uncertainty about the need for the police clearance letter, the best approach is to confirm directly with the directions provided by the competent authorities.
